Re: [syslog-ng] sysutils/syslog-ng/files/syslong-ng.sh.in patch

2006-11-29 Thread Brian A. Seklecki
 * of alcohol. :}
 

Betsy was a Himalayan Mountain Goat, and I'm the Sherpa.

~BAS

 Ahh. That explains the jpeg of you and the llamas. :)
-- 
Brian A. Seklecki [EMAIL PROTECTED]
Collaborative Fusion, Inc.

___
freebsd-ports@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-ports
To unsubscribe, send any mail to [EMAIL PROTECTED]


Re: [syslog-ng] sysutils/syslog-ng/files/syslong-ng.sh.in patch

2006-11-06 Thread Brian A. Seklecki
Yep.  I sent about 75 messages the other night well under the influence
of a *LOT* of alcohol. :}

~BAS

On Sun, 2006-11-05 at 23:37 -0500, [EMAIL PROTECTED] wrote:
 On Fri, 03 Nov 2006 21:31:59 EST, Brian A. Seklecki said:
 
  +syslog_ng_purgeklog=${syslog_ng_purgeklig-NO}
 
 klig?  Typo?
-- 
Brian A. Seklecki [EMAIL PROTECTED]
Collaborative Fusion, Inc.

___
freebsd-ports@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-ports
To unsubscribe, send any mail to [EMAIL PROTECTED]


Re: [syslog-ng] sysutils/syslog-ng/files/syslong-ng.sh.in patch

2006-11-06 Thread Valdis . Kletnieks
On Mon, 06 Nov 2006 09:21:43 EST, Brian A. Seklecki said:
 Yep.  I sent about 75 messages the other night well under the influence
 of a *LOT* of alcohol. :}

Ahh. That explains the jpeg of you and the llamas. :)


pgpkxJKDBctcQ.pgp
Description: PGP signature


Re: [syslog-ng] sysutils/syslog-ng/files/syslong-ng.sh.in patch

2006-11-05 Thread Valdis . Kletnieks
On Fri, 03 Nov 2006 21:31:59 EST, Brian A. Seklecki said:

 +syslog_ng_purgeklog=${syslog_ng_purgeklig-NO}

klig?  Typo?


pgp9Go9NERoGK.pgp
Description: PGP signature


sysutils/syslog-ng/files/syslong-ng.sh.in patch

2006-11-03 Thread Brian A. Seklecki


This is a nice little patch we use to purge out /dev/klog after 
/etc/rc.d/dmesg and before /usr/local/etc/rc.d/syslog-ng.sh.


It's useful for shops that translate user.info facility/priority syslog 
messages into SMS/E-Mail via a log{} mechanism (i.e., hardware error 
messages from the kernel, like some flunky in the NOC plugging a keyboard 
into your system).


It lets you avoid 200 lines of boot messages in log(9) making their way 
into your log{} mechanism or into your pager.


We want to feed it upstream because we think others will find it useful.

~BAS

$ diff -u /usr/ports/sysutils/syslog-ng/files/syslog-ng.sh.in 
syslog-ng.sh.in


--- /usr/ports/sysutils/syslog-ng/files/syslog-ng.sh.in Wed Mar 29 
16:20:19 2006

+++ syslog-ng.sh.in Fri Nov  3 20:32:59 2006
@@ -14,6 +14,8 @@
 #syslog_ng_enable=YES
 #

+syslog_ng_purgeklog=${syslog_ng_purgeklig-NO}
+
 . %%RC_SUBR%%

 name=syslog_ng
@@ -23,6 +25,11 @@
 required_files=%%PREFIX%%/etc/syslog-ng/syslog-ng.conf
 pidfile=/var/run/syslog.pid
 extra_commands=reload
+
+if checkyesno syslog_ng_purgeklog; then
+start_precmd=echo \Purging klog(9)\  sysctl -w 
kern.msgbuf_clear=1 $start_precmd;

+fi
+
 stop_postcmd=stop_postcmd

 load_rc_config $name



l8*
-lava (Brian A. Seklecki - Pittsburgh, PA, USA)
   http://www.spiritual-machines.org/

...from back in the heady days when helpdesk meant nothing, diskquota
meant everything, and lives could be bought and sold for a couple of pages
of laser printout - and frequently were.
___
freebsd-ports@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-ports
To unsubscribe, send any mail to [EMAIL PROTECTED]